Solution

The correct options are
A Loose-fitting cotton garments
C Headgear
Cravats and bonnets are clothing items specific to Europe during and after the Victorian Era. Ali was an Arabian trader. He would most likely have worn loose and comfortable clothing. He might also have worn a turban or headcloth to protect his head from the intensity of the sun.
